Lava Kusa is an animated film made with a budget of $5 million over 4.5 years by a team of 400 people. It uses state-of-the-art visual effects and is filmed in four languages with the goal of putting India on the map of international animation. The film has a strong storyline, brilliantly choreographed action sequences, and music composed by L.S. Vaidyanathan and sung by popular artists to appeal to all age groups.
